Which Injuries Are the Most Common?

The five most common personal injuries in Houston are auto accidents, slip and fall injuries, defective product injuries, medical malpractice, and dog bite injuries. Auto accidents can involve various circumstances and parties, so this kind of personal injury case can be long and require an extensive investigation. After filing a personal injury claim, you can recover financially depending on who was at fault and both parties’ insurance. Slip and fall injuries and dog bite injuries can result in severe head injuries, brain injuries, as well as neurological damage. If these injuries are due to someone else’s negligence, you can seek financial coverage. Medical malpractice can result in a very controversial personal injury case, resulting from a doctor or physician’s negligence when treating you. You have to prove the doctor’s failure to provide effective care with hard evidence. Lastly, defective product injuries can occur in your vehicle, your home, or at work, and under product liability laws, you can prove that the seller or manufacturer was negligent when they produced and sold the defective product.
